WLW, GL. The Keeper of Time is displeased with you and wants to punish you.
Your life was a measured, predictable cycle. Work in the office, meeting up with friends on the weekends. The days merged into one gray spot, until one day on your way home, you stumbled upon a strange object in a puddle. It was an antique pocket watch with intricate carvings. Out of curiosity, you picked it up.
At home, after cleaning the find, you discovered an unusual mechanism and a strange button on the side. When you pressed it, the ticking stopped. And outside the window, the birds froze, the cars stopped, and the people froze. Your heart pounded with delight and horror; you held the power of time in your hands.
The next day marked the point of no return. Stopping time, you walked into the store past frozen cashiers and security guards, picking up a bag of deli food and expensive alcohol. That was just the beginning. Your watch became your passport to a world without rules. You took whatever you wanted: money from ATMs, clothes from boutiques, jewelry.
That evening, when you returned to your apartment with a huge bag of stolen designer clothes, the world suddenly swam before your eyes. The floor gave way beneath your feet, and in an instant you found yourself in an incomprehensible space. Thousands of clocks, from ancient sand-glasses to futuristic chronometers, floated around you in a silent dance.
Before you, towering above the flow of time, stood the Guardian. Her hair was snow-white, her eyes shone with a cold light, and she held a staff in her hands. Her face, usually motionless, was contorted with anger.
"Enough, " her voice rang out, like an echo of centuries. "You have disappointed me, child."
The Keeper took a step forward, and her shining eyes seemed to see every theft, every petty meanness.
"You did terrible things with my watch, using the gift of time for petty gain and malice. I do not forgive that."
She raised her staff and the gears at the top of it began to spin.
"I must punish you for this, " the Guardian continued. "You will remain here. And you will sit in a dungeon, outside the flow of time, where a single moment can last an eternity. Your sentence is one hundred and fifty years."
